Block 685,819

Block Hash

67e99c978829f918677236bbb82594e5b26cd43e77a8b559a08b5b7d3984d874

Previous Block Hash

4868f15693011b6b18de95c3e58e648e0174dbb15bbbbcdf4d89445676b891fa

Mined

Transactions

2

Difficulty

34.46 M

Size

363 bytes

Transactions (2)

1 input, 1 output
10,000.0187584 PEPE
1 input, 1 output
12,805,324.97020154 PEPE